Recently, one of my articles was edited and moved to a network site. I noticed that a relevant video was removed - no big deal but are those perhaps not recommended anymore the way they used to be? If so, I won't bother adding them anymore.
Also, gentle suggestion for the editors, new and experienced here: When you rearrange capsules in an article make sure that the content still flows/is in order. I had to go in and rewrite the endings to capsules because after some rearranging by the editors the article no longer made sense. I don't mind doing this but for the sake of content quality and cutting back on bounce rates, it's something to be mindful of in the future, especially because not all writers go in and check to see that the editing didn't compromise the integrity and readability of the piece.
I've had the same issue on occasion. The decision to remove images or videos appears to be capricious and not of great importance. I recall advice somewhere along the line from HP that including videos increases viewership; how they know that is a mystery to me. So, I'd say keep including videos.
Yes, paragraphs do rarely get moved about so it's incumbent on writers to carefully go over their articles after editing. Editors, like writers, are not perfect.
